There has been a lot of talk lately about laser and CNC training.
I'd like to throw a suggestion out there.
These are both industrial style machines that i think would benefit from structured
training days. Probably a good 5-6 hours going through all the stages in a structured
lesson, similar to the way welding and courses I run are conducted.
And possibly with laser and CNC split over two weekends.This can also be accompanied
by handouts with picture/photo references of each stage.
I personally have been trained on laser but have since forgotten most of it.
If everyone had something to refer back to and had a decent amount of time to concentrate
on the tasks, it would probably make the operation of these machines less problematic.
Because of the time devoted by people training I don't see a problem charging for these
lessons, whatever that amount maybe. And also with an at least two week notice so
positions to attend course can be allocated, and there is clear sign up and notice for
all parties involved.
